Does Synology 920 support hot swapping?
The DS920+ supports Hot Swap, and the drive tray is revealed simply by pulling the front so that the locking mechanism is released, and the tray slides out. All in all, the DS920+ can house four drives, and it supports both 2.5” and 3.5” drives.

Where are the USB ports on the Synology ds918 +?
Down at the bottom, you have a single USB 3.0 port and power button. Around the back, there are two Gigabit Ethernet ports, another USB 3.0 port, Kensington lock, and an eSATA port.
